Position Overview:
We are seeking a dedicated Quality Control Specialist to ensure that our products meet the highest standards of food safety, consistency, and quality. The ideal candidate will have experience in the food manufacturing industry, preferably in confectionery, and a strong understanding of food safety standards (SFDA, HACCP, ISO, etc.).

Key Responsibilities:
  • Inspect raw materials, in-process products, and finished goods to ensure compliance with quality standards.
  • Monitor production lines to ensure proper hygiene, handling, and packaging practices.
  • Implement and maintain HACCP and ISO-based quality systems.
  • Conduct sensory, physical, and microbiological testing where applicable.
  • Investigate and document customer complaints, defects, or non-conformities and recommend corrective actions.
  • Maintain quality records, reports, and compliance documentation for audits.
  • Collaborate with production, procurement, and warehouse teams to ensure consistent quality.
  • Provide training to staff on quality and hygiene practices as needed.

Requirements:
  • Diploma or Bachelor’s degree in Food Science, Quality Management, or related field.
  • Minimum 23 years of experience in food manufacturing (confectionery or FMCG preferred).
  • Knowledge of HACCP, ISO 22000, and SFDA regulations.
  • Strong attention to detail, organizational skills, and ability to work in fast-paced environments.
  • Ability to work flexible hours when required.
  • Fluency in Arabic (English preferred).

Join EVA Pharma as a Quality Control Specialist!
We are a leading pharmaceutical company dedicated to empowering health and well-being as a fundamental human right. As a recognized best place to work, we foster a supportive and innovative environment for our team members.

Job Summary: We are seeking a passionate and talented Quality Control Specialist to join our dynamic team in Saudi Arabia. You will contribute to our mission of enhancing human health and ensuring that we meet the highest standards of excellence in our industry.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Perform chemical and physical tests on raw materials, intermediates, and finished products using techniques like HPLC, GC, UV, and FTIR.
  • Ensure adherence to cGMP, GLP, and SOPs; accurately record test results, deviations, and observations.
  • Operate, calibrate, and maintain laboratory instruments according to schedule and SOPs.
  • Handle sample receiving, labeling, and traceability; ensure data integrity and proper documentation practices.
  • Assist with method development, audits, training, and inventory/reagent management while contributing to continuous improvement efforts.

Requirements:
  • Bachelor's degree in Science, Biotechnology, or Pharmacy with 02 years of relevant lab experience.
  • Basic knowledge of GMP/GLP, lab safety, wet chemistry techniques, and instruments like HPLC and UV-Vis.
  • Strong attention to detail, time management, adaptability, teamwork, and communication skills.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and basic LIMS or digital documentation systems.
  • Demonstrated reliability, receptiveness to feedback, problem-solving ability, and focus on regulatory compliance and data accuracy.

Note: Saudi manufacturing experience is a MUST.

Join Amazon's MENA Grocery Team!
Are you interested in shaping the future of grocery shopping and improving customer experiences? The MENA Grocery team (UFG) is offering an exciting opportunity to become a Quality Specialist, where you will influence the quality of our meat, seafood, produce, and perishable items.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Review the quality of Meat, Seafood, Fruits, Vegetables, Eggs, and other perishable items during the inbound process.
  • Reject damaged or defective items back to the vendor and document the items accordingly.
  • Audit quality during picking and packing processes.
  • Monitor packaging standards throughout the packing process.
  • Perform daily audits of bins and provide weekly/daily reports to stakeholders.
  • Train store and hub associates on quality standards, SOPs, and packaging.
The role may require occasional weekend work, not exceeding a 40-hour work week.

Desired Traits:
  • Strong eye for detail and operational excellence.
  • Excellent interpersonal skills and ability to build collaborative relationships.
  • Problem-solving mindset and ability to implement process improvements.
  • Proficiency in handling data and reporting accurately.
  • Willingness to take initiative and handle additional responsibilities.
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ree.
  • Fluency in Arabic (speaking, writing, and reading).
  • Knowledge of Excel and PowerPoint.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• HACCP and PIC 3 certification (SFDA) and knowledge of fruit and vegetable quality specifications is preferred.
